Overall Satisfaction with Exclaimer
Our company basically has 4 separate business units that need to appear "somewhat" cohesive while also still remaining separate and free to create their own email signatures. Exclaimer allows for a dedicated set of managers at each business unit to admin the users for that business unit, while also being able to duplicate/copy/modify signatures from other business units to allow for more cohesive brand styling between our business units and the parent company. Exclaimer utilizes data within Active Directory including custom fields, and then admins can utilize those fields to populate data for users along with unit-wide information (such as marketing graphics or even departmental promos).

- There are a few UI elements that could be improved. Sometimes fields are slow to respond to input...but you get used to the little quirks pretty quickly.
- After editing a signature, you currently have to return to the root level of all signatures instead of back to a list of your business unit signatures. This could be improved.
- While Exclaimer allows for the integration of custom AD fields, I've been told this is a slow process and somewhat problematic. There isn't a way to test data integration until after it has been pushed to production, so errors can result in massive delays if a business unit has to wait until the next production push before proceeding.

Email templates for the signatures are our primary use case. We have 6 signature variations required at just my business unit, and I'm able to duplicate a template and then modify the rules and design as needed very quickly. And if the parent organization deems a more cohesive design is required, they are able to share that template with each business unit for them to customize as needed while still retaining the primary branding elements.
We have not had any security issues or incidents (yet) with Exclaimer providing our email signatures for our organization. There were a few issues when they initially rolled out the new web UI, but once those were resolved, it was fairly seemless. I've never experienced any downtime that I'm aware of.
Prior to Exclaimer, we would email a business unit signature template/design to everyone in the business unit along with instructions for how to implement within Outlook. Doing it this way, we still ran into consistency issues between employee signatures for various reasons. Once we switched to using Exclaimer, we immediately became more consistent. And the marketing team was able to push new content to everyone at the business unit at once and in a timely manner.
